This intelligence will learn all about us. Hence, a great many of the mundane things we do will be handled by the "assistant". This brings up major issues for an industry such as advertising; watch out Google and Facebook.

Advertising was instantly changed with the development of blockchain and cryptocurrency. Even though we have not seen it yet, there is going to be a day where the platforms are removed (the middlemen) in favor of direct contact. This means that advertisers will pay individual via a cryptocurrency to view their ads. If you choose to watch or read an advert, you will be compensated.

This is only a transition phase. When we get to the place where AI assistants are ordering things for us, advertising is basically finished. The area where computers excel over humans is in processing data. An assistant of this sort has the ability to make a purchase based upon our likes, cost, health benefits, availability, and fit into an overall budget. Whatever the parameters, it can scour the cyberworld to meet our needs. In fact, for most regular items, it will do this automatically without our asking.

Which brings up the point of advertising. There is no point to it. Our AI assistant is not going to watch a bunch of ads. It does not care. This is going to radically alter an industry that is over $500B a year. It will be able to process all the information about every product in a particular category to determine what best meets our personal needs.

And this is how your refrigerator and cupboards will be able to order your groceries for you.

Picture a day where you do not care about any advertisements since you do not need the information. Your AI assistant will be the one to gather all the data for you. The only decision we have to make is for the non-ordinary purchases .

The next 10-15 years will make Google ads seem as foreign as scenes from Mad Men.

It is also one of the main reasons why decentralization is so important. We need to control these systems in our lives, not corporations who have interests that are far different from our own.
